Subj:    Permanent Change of Station; Order to

1.    On 9 August 1970, you will proceed and report to the OIC/NCOIC of the III Transient Facility, Danang Air Force Base, for further transportation to CONUS. Your flight date is 11 August 1970. Advance travel pay is not authorized. Advance travel pay is authorized in the exectution of these orders.

2.    You are authorized thirty (30) days delay to count as annual leave. Your leave balance as of 30 Junt (sic)1970 is indicated opposite your name.

3.     Your pay record, health and dental records and your Service Record Book is entrusted to your care for delivery to your next duty station.

4.     You are directed to insert a copy of these orders on the top inside each piece of accompanying baggage.
